Bamako in May
In May, Bamako averages 38°C (100°F) during the day and 27°C (80°F) at night, with around 13 days of rain (37 mm total).

How May compares to the rest of the year in Bamako
May is one of the warmest months in Bamako (3rd of 12) and moderately rainy compared to the rest of the year (6th of 12). Daytime temperature runs 4°C above the annual average (34°C). May runs 2°C cooler than April (39°C) and cools 3°C in June (34°C).

Bamako in other months
| Month | Avg high | Avg low | Rainfall | Rain days | Snow days |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| January | 33°C / 91°F | 18°C / 65°F | 1 mm | 1 | — |
| February | 36°C / 96°F | 21°C / 70°F | 0 mm | 1 | — |
| March | 38°C / 100°F | 24°C / 76°F | 1 mm | 1 | — |
| April | 39°C / 103°F | 27°C / 80°F | 3 mm | 4 | — |
| May | 38°C / 100°F | 27°C / 80°F | 37 mm | 13 | — |
| June | 34°C / 94°F | 25°C / 77°F | 82 mm | 20 | — |
| July | 30°C / 87°F | 23°C / 74°F | 184 mm | 27 | — |
| August | 29°C / 84°F | 23°C / 73°F | 214 mm | 29 | — |
| September | 30°C / 86°F | 23°C / 73°F | 144 mm | 25 | — |
| October | 33°C / 91°F | 23°C / 74°F | 36 mm | 15 | — |
| November | 35°C / 94°F | 21°C / 71°F | 1 mm | 1 | — |
| December | 33°C / 91°F | 19°C / 66°F | 0 mm | 0 | — |
